자동차 시스템 아키텍처에서 IG 전원(주로 IGN 또는 IG1/IG2로 불림)과 B+ 전원은 차량의 전원 공급 시스템에서 중요한 역할을 하는데, 이는 시동 키(또는 버튼 시동) 상태에 따라 다르게 공급되는 전원 유형을 구분하기 위한 것입니다. 이는 배터리(12V 시스템)의 전력을 효율적으로 관리하고, 불필요한 전력 소비를 방지하며, 안전성을 높이기 위한 설계입니다. 아래에서 차이점을 자세히 설명하겠습니다.
1. B+ 전원 (Battery Positive, 상시 전원)
- 정의: 배터리의 양극(+) 단자에 직접 연결된 상시 공급 전원입니다. 차량의 시동 키가 OFF 상태이거나 키가 뽑혀 있어도 항상 전원이 공급됩니다. (예: 12V 배터리 직결)
- 공급 조건: 키 위치와 무관하게 지속적으로 공급. 엔진이 꺼진 상태에서도 작동합니다.
- 사용 예시:
- 시계, 비상등, 실내등, 전동 시트 메모리, ECU(엔진 제어 유닛)의 기본 백업.
- 블랙박스나 알람 시스템처럼 주차 중에도 작동해야 하는 장치(상시 녹화 기능 등)에 연결.
- 특징:
- 장점: 안정적이고 항상 사용 가능.
- 단점: 시동 OFF 시에도 전원이 흘러 배터리 방전 위험이 있음. (예: 장기 주차 시 충전기나 불필요 장치 연결 시 주의 필요)
- 아키텍처상: 차량의 메인 배터리 라인에 속하며, 릴레이나 퓨즈를 통해 보호됩니다.
2. IG 전원 (Ignition 전원, 점화 전원)
- 정의: 시동 키의 위치(ACC, ON, START)에 따라 공급되는 제어된 전원으로, 주로 IGN1(IG1) 또는 IGN2(IG2)로 세분화됩니다. 이는 엔진 점화(Ignition)와 관련된 시스템을 제어하기 위해 설계된 전원입니다.
- 공급 조건:
- IG1 (또는 ON 전원): 시동 키가 ON 위치 이상(ON 또는 START)일 때 공급. 스타트 모터(엔진 시동 시)가 회전하는 동안에도 지속적으로 공급됩니다. (대부분의 전자 장치가 이 전원을 사용)
- IG2 (또는 START 전원): 시동 키가 ON 위치일 때 공급되지만, 스타트 모터가 동작하는 순간(시동 걸 때) 일시적으로 차단됩니다. 시동 후 다시 공급.
- ACC(Accessory) 전원은 IG의 하위 개념으로, 키가 ACC 또는 ON 위치일 때 공급되며 라디오, 네비게이션 등에 사용되지만 시동 중 끊길 수 있습니다.
- 사용 예시:
- IG1: 인스트루먼트 패널(계기판), ECU, 에어컨 팬, 대부분의 전자 제어 시스템.
- IG2: 헤드라이트, 일부 안전 장치(시동 시 과부하 방지).
- 전체 IG: 시동 키 ON 시 작동하는 모든 시스템(예: 오디오, 시거잭 일부).
- 특징:
- 장점: 키 OFF 시 자동 차단되어 배터리 방전 방지. 시동 과정에서 전력 우선순위를 스타터에 할당(IG2 차단으로).
- 단점: 상시가 아니므로 주차 중 작동 불가(블랙박스 등은 B+와 병행 사용).
- 아키텍처상: 키 스위치(Key Switch) 또는 버튼 시동 시스템(SMK, PDM)과 연동되어 릴레이로 제어됩니다. 현대 차량에서는 버튼 시동에서도 동일 원리 적용.

- 근본 차이: B+는 "항상 켜짐" 상태로 배터리 전력을 무조건적으로 공급하지만, IG는 "운전 상태"에 따라 동적으로 공급되어 에너지 관리를 최적화합니다. 이는 자동차의 전기 시스템이 복잡해짐에 따라(예: ADAS, 인포테인먼트) 필수적입니다. 전기차(EV)에서도 유사하게 적용되지만, 고전압 배터리와 저전압(12V) 시스템(LDC 변환기)을 통해 B+가 상시 유지됩니다.
- 실제 적용 팁: 액세서리(예: 블랙박스) 설치 시 B+를 상시 녹화에, IG를 주행 중 작동에 사용하세요. 잘못 연결하면 배터리 방전이나 시스템 오류 발생 가능. 차종에 따라 퓨즈 박스에서 확인하세요.
핵심 요약: "상시 전원 vs. 차량 작동 전원"
- B+ (Battery Positive, 상시 전원): 배터리에 직접 연결된, 항상 '켜져 있는(Hot at all times)' 전원 라인입니다. 차 키를 꽂지 않아도, 심지어 배터리 단자만 연결되어 있으면 항상 전압(보통 12V)이 존재합니다.
- Ignition 전원 (IGN, KL.15, Accessory/Run 전원): 운전자가 키를 돌려 차량을 '작동 시킬 때만(KOEO, Key On Engine On)' 활성화되는 전원 라인입니다. 키를 빼거나 ACC 위치로 돌리면 전원이 차단됩니다.

아키텍처 다이어그램에서의 표현과 연결

기능안전(ISO 26262) 관점에서의 중대한 차이
이 구분은 단순한 전원 라인이 아니라, 안전 상태와 진단 범위를 정의하는 기준선입니다.
- 안전 상태(Safe State) 정의:
- IGN 전원이 끊어졌을 때(= 운전자가 차를 끔), 시스템은 종종 물리적으로 해제되는 상태가 안전 상태로 정의될 수 있습니다. (예: 모터 토크 0, 솔레노이드 오프).
- B+ 전원이 끊어졌을 때(= 배터리가 완전히 분리됨) 는 차량 전체의 최후의 안전 상태입니다. 이 경우 모든 전자 시스템은 기능 정지가 기본 상태입니다.
- 전원 관련 안전 메커니즘:
- IGN 전원 감시: IGN 전원이 갑자기 꺼지면(예: 사고로 인한 단선), 시스템은 최소한의 에너지로 짧은 시간 안에 안전한 종료 절차를 실행해야 합니다 (예: 에어백 전용 백업 캐패시터 사용).
- B+ 전원 감시: B+ 전원의 과전압/저전압을 감시하여, ECU의 메모리 손상이나 오동작을 방지하는 안전 메커니즘이 필요합니다. 특히 EEPROM/플래시 메모리 쓰기 시 B+ 전원 안정성은 치명적입니다.
- 대기 모드(Sleep Mode)에서의 안전:
- B+는 공급되지만 IGN은 꺼진 상태에서, ECU는 초저전력 수면 모드에 들어갑니다.
- 그러나 이 상태에서도 일부 안전 관련 기능은 살아있어야 할 수 있습니다. (예: 주차 중 충격 감지, 보안 경보, OTA 소프트웨어 업데이트 대기).
- 이 모드에서의 고장은 깨어났을 때(Key-On 시) 반드시 진단되어야 합니다. (예: 수면 모드 중 CAN 트랜시버 고장을 감지하고, Key-On 시 해당 DTC를 설정).
- 하드웨어 설계와 진단:
- IGN 전원 라인은 메인 MCU, 센서, 액츄에이터 등 고전력 부품을 구동합니다.
- B+ 전원 라인은 전원 관리 IC(PMIC), 실시간 클락(RTC), CAN 트랜시버의 대기 회로 등 저전력 부품을 구동합니다.
- 각 라인에 대한 별도의 과전압 보호(OVP), 저전압 감지(UVD) 회로가 필요할 수 있습니다.
결론: 안전 엔지니어의 관점에서
- IGN 전원은 "운전 중(Acive Mode)" 의 안전을 담당합니다.
- B+ 전원은 "차량 수명 전체(Lifetime), 특히 대기 상태(Sleep Mode)" 의 안전을 담당합니다.
따라서 시스템 요구사항을 정의할 때는 "Key-On 상태에서...", "Key-Off 상태에서...", "Sleep 모드 중에는..." 과 같이 전원 상태를 명시적으로 구분하여 요구사항을 작성해야 합니다. 이것이 바로 앞서 논의한 6.4.1.2절("운용 모드 및 시스템 상태와 관련된...") 이 강조하는 내용의 구체적인 실례입니다. 이 두 전원의 이해 없이는 진정한 차량 전자 시스템 아키텍처 설계가 불가능합니다.
궁금한 점이, 방금 설명한 것들에 대해 실제 물리적 구조가 궁금한데, 일반적으로 B+와 IG 전원은 모두 같은 배터리에서 전원을 공급하는 거고 서로 다른 채널로 신호를 보내는 거야? 아니면 B+ 전원과 IG전원의 전원 공급을 해주는 물리적 엘리먼트는 독립적인 거야
짧은 답변: B+와 IGN 전원은 "같은 배터리"에서 나오지만, "완전히 다른 경로와 스위치를 거치는 독립적인 라인"입니다. 물리적 엘리먼트는 일부 공유하지만, 대부분 독립적입니다.
물리적 구조의 진실: "공통의 원천, 독립적인 길"

상세 설명
1. 공통의 원천: 배터리
- 물리적 전기의 최종 원천은 하나의 12V 차량 배터리입니다. 이 점에서는 공유합니다.
2. 분기점과 독립성: 퓨즈 박스와 키 스위치
여기서부터 완전히 분리됩니다.
- B+ (상시 전원) 라인의 경로:
- 배터리 (+) → 메인 퓨즈(Main Fuse) → B+ 전원 레일.
- B+ 레일에서 각 ECU/부하로 가는 개별 퓨즈를 통해 직렬로 분배됩니다.
- 이 라인에는 키 스위치가 끼어들지 않습니다. 배터리가 연결되는 순간부터 항상 '핫(Hot)'합니다.
- IGN (Key-On) 전원 라인의 경로:
- 배터리 (+) → 메인 퓨즈 → Ignition Switch (물리적 키 또는 버튼).
- 키 스위치가 ACC 또는 RUN 위치로 돌아가면, 스위치는 IGN 릴레이(또는 전자식 파워 트랜지스터)를 제어하는 신호를 보냅니다.
- IGN 릴레이가 접점을 닫으면서, 별도의 IGN 전원 레일에 전원을 공급합니다.
- 이 IGN 레일에서 각 ECU/부하로 가는 또 다른 세트의 개별 퓨즈를 통해 분배됩니다.
- 키를 끄면 릴레이가 열리고, IGN 라인 전체에 전압이 사라집니다.
ECU 내부에서의 물리적 연결 (가장 중요한 차이)
이것이 바로 아키텍처 설계의 핵심입니다. 하나의 ECU가 두 라인을 다르게 사용합니다.

- B+ 핀에 연결된 내부 회로: 저전력, 항상 켜져 있어야 하는 기능. 예: 전원 관리 IC, 실시간 시계(RTC), DTC를 저장하는 비휘발성 메모리의 유지 전원, CAN 트랜시버의 대기 모드 회로.
- IGN 핀에 연결된 내부 회로: 고전력, 차량 작동 시에만 필요한 기능. 예: 메인 5V/3.3V 레귤레이터(이 레귤레이터가 메인 MCU, 센서, 로직에 전원 공급), 인젝터/램프 드라이버.
기능안전 관점에서 이 독립성이 의미하는 것
- 고장 격리: IGN 라인에 단락 고장이 발생해 해당 퓨즈가 끊어져도, B+ 라인은 정상적으로 동작하여 최소한의 기능(예: 도어 잠금, 진단 코드 저장)을 유지할 수 있습니다. 반대의 경우도 마찬가지입니다.
- 전원 모니터링의 분리:
- ECU는 B+ 전압과 IGN 전압을 별도로 모니터링합니다.
- B+ 저전압 감지: 배터리 방전을 예측하고, 메모리 쓰기 작업을 중단하여 데이터 손상을 방지하는 안전 메커니즘입니다.
- IGN 전압 감지: 메인 시스템의 정상 작동 여부를 판단. IGN 전압이 불안정하면 시스템을 안전하게 리셋하거나 경고를 줄 수 있습니다.
- 수면/대기 모드 구현의 기초: Key-Off(IGN 꺼짐) 후 ECU는 B+ 전원만으로 저전력 수면 모드에 진입합니다. 이 모드에서도 B+ 라인을 통해 공급받는 RTC나 CAN 수신기는 일부 작동하여 '깨어나야 할 조건'을 감시할 수 있습니다.
결론
B+와 IGN은 "형제"지만, "쌍둥이"가 아닙니다.
- 같은 부모(배터리)에게서 태어났지만,
- 서로 다른 문(B+는 직통문, IGN은 키가 있는 문) 을 통해 나오고,
- 서로 다른 길(퓨즈, 릴레이, 배선) 을 걸어가며,
- ECU 내에서도 서로 다른 방(저전력 방 vs. 고전력 방) 에 들어가 일합니다.
이러한 물리적 분리는 전원 도메인 분리(Power Domain Isolation) 의 기본이며, 차량 전자 시스템의 신뢰성, 기능성, 그리고 안전성을 보장하는 토대입니다. 이 구조를 이해해야만 정확한 시스템 요구사항을 작성하고, 효과적인 안전 메커니즘을 설계할 수 있습니다.
방금 너가 설명한 '전원 모니터링의 분리'에서 말하는 ECU는 메인 MCU와 다른 엘리먼트인거지? 그렇게 생각하는 이유는 너가 메인 MCU는 IG전원에 의해 작동한다 했는데 그 말은 IG 전압은 메인 MCU의 입력인 것이고 그렇기 때문에 만약 IG전압을 감지하는 게 메인 MCU이면 애초에 입력인 IG전압이 들어오지 않으면 메인 MCU가 작동하지 않을테니까 완전 말도 안되는 짓을 하는 거니깐 말이야
정확합니다! 100% 맞는 추론입니다. 사용자님의 생각이 완벽히 옳습니다. 여기서 중요한 개념적 오해를 바로잡을 기회입니다.
제가 설명을 부족하게 했습니다. "ECU가 모니터링한다"는 표현을 할 때, 그 주체를 명확히 하지 않아 혼란을 드렸네요.
핵심 교정: "전원 모니터링은 '메인 MCU'가 아니라 '전원 관리 하드웨어'가 한다."
사용자님의 지적처럼, 메인 MCU는 IGN 전원으로 구동되는 '부하(Load)'입니다. IGN 전원이 없으면 메인 MCU는 죽은 상태이므로, IGN 전압을 측정할 수조차 없습니다.
진정한 물리적 구조는 다음과 같습니다:
1. IGN 전원 라인 감지 (메인 MCU가 깨어나기 '전'의 감지)
- 감지 주체: 전원 관리 IC(PMIC) 또는 독립적인 아날로그 비교기 회로가 담당합니다.
- 위치: 이 부품들은 B+ 상시 전원으로 구동됩니다.
- 작동 원리:
- IGN 라인이 활성화되면, 그 전압은 PMIC의 'IGN_OK' 핀 같은 곳에 입력됩니다.
- B+로 구동되는 PMIC가 이 전압을 감지하여, "아, IGN 전원이 들어왔구나"를 판단합니다.
- PMIC는 이 신호를 기반으로 메인 레귤레이터를 켜서, 메인 MCU에게 전원을 공급합니다.
- 결론: IGN 전원의 유무/정상 여부는 메인 MCU가 깨어나기 이전 단계에서, B+ 전원으로 살아있는 독립 하드웨어가 판단합니다.
2. IGN 전원 품질 감지 (메인 MCU가 깨어난 '후'의 감지)
- 메인 MCU가 구동된 후에는, MCU 내부의 ADC(Analog-to-Digital Converter) 를 이용해 IGN 전원 라인의 전압 수준을 모니터링할 수 있습니다.
- 그러나 이는 "전원이 아예 없는가?" 가 아니라 "전원이 불안정하거나(리플), 과전압/저전압인가?" 를 감지하기 위한 것입니다.
- 만약 IGN 전압이 ADC 측정이 불가능할 정도로 낮아지면, MCU는 정상 작동을 멈추고, 다시 B+로 구동되는 PMIC나 와치독 회로가 그 상황을 감지하게 됩니다.
3. B+ 전원 감지
- 이는 더욱 명확합니다. B+ 전원은 PMIC의 직접적인 입력 전원입니다.
- PMIC는 B+ 전압을 지속적으로 모니터링하여, 저전압/과전압 시 메인 MCU에게 리셋 신호를 보내거나, 플래시 메모리 쓰기 작업을 차단하는 등의 안전 조치를 취합니다.
- 메인 MCU가 꺼져 있는(Sleep 모드) 동안에도 이 감지는 B+로 구동되는 PMIC에 의해 지속됩니다.

기능안전적 결론
사용자님의 지적은 안전 메커니즘 설계의 기본 원리인 "독립성" 을 다시 한번 확인시켜 줍니다.
"한 요소의 고장(또는 부재)을 감지하는 기능은, 그 요소에 의존하지 않는 독립된 경로를 통해 이루어져야 한다."
- IGN 전원의 유무/정상 여부는 B+ 전원 계열의 하드웨어(PMIC) 가 감시합니다.
- 메인 MCU의 동작 여부는 와치독 타이머(독립 클럭 소스) 가 감시합니다.
- B+ 전원의 품질은 PMIC 자체의 내부 회로가 감시합니다.
이러한 계층적이고 독립적인 감시 구조가 바로 시스템이 신뢰할 수 있게 깨어나고, 안전하게 작동하며, 적절하게 잠들 수 있도록 보장합니다. 사용자님의 비판은 이 중요한 원리를 명확히 하는 데 큰 도움이 되었습니다. 감사합니다.
'엔지니어링 용어' 카테고리의 다른 글
| DV, PV 단계 (0) | 2025.10.24 |
|---|---|
| HKMC_PROTO, ESIR, ISIR (0) | 2025.09.23 |
| register (0) | 2025.09.16 |
| Trace32, MIL, SIL, PIL, HIL (0) | 2025.09.12 |
| NVH 환경조건 (0) | 2025.09.04 |